在网络游戏、高清视频流媒体和远程办公日益普及的今天,网络延迟和稳定性已成为影响用户体验的关键因素。WireGuard作为一种现代、高效且安全的VPN协议,因其简洁的代码和卓越的性能而备受青睐。然而,即便是优秀的协议,在实际网络环境中也可能因配置不当或网络波动而无法发挥全部潜力。本文将深入技术层面,分享一系列针对WireGuard协议的优化技巧,旨在帮助用户,特别是QuickQ服务的用户,有效降低延迟,实现更稳定、更流畅的游戏加速与网络体验。
引言:为何需要优化WireGuard?
WireGuard协议本身设计精良,但其性能表现与服务器节点质量、本地网络环境、系统配置参数等密切相关。默认配置通常追求兼容性,未必能针对特定场景(如低延迟游戏)进行极致优化。通过精细调整,我们可以减少数据包传输路径上的开销,提升连接响应速度,这对于分秒必争的竞技游戏和实时通信至关重要。作为一款注重性能的网络工具,QuickQ的架构已经为WireGuard的高效运行奠定了基础,而用户端的进一步优化则能锦上添花。
核心优化技巧:从技术层面降低延迟
1. 优选服务器节点与MTU值调优
延迟的第一大来源是物理距离和数据包路径。选择地理位置上靠近您且网络质量高的服务器节点是根本。QuickQ通常提供多个节点,建议使用内置测速工具选择延迟最低、丢包率最小的节点。
其次,MTU(最大传输单元)设置不当会导致数据包分片,增加开销和延迟。WireGuard默认MTU为1420,但最佳值需根据实际网络路径确定。您可以使用`ping -f -l <数据包大小> <服务器IP>`命令(在Windows下)进行测试,找到不发生分片的最大值(通常为1500减去协议开销,如1380-1420之间),并在WireGuard配置文件中(如`[Interface]`部分添加`MTU = 1380`)进行设置。一个经过MTU优化的QuickQ连接能有效减少传输层重传,提升效率。
2. 调整持久化Keepalive与连接保活
在NAT(网络地址转换)环境或存在严格防火墙的网络中,不活跃的连接可能会被中断,导致重连延迟。WireGuard的`PersistentKeepalive`参数可以定期发送保活数据包,维持会话状态。对于游戏加速这种需要长连接稳定的场景,建议在配置文件的`[Peer]`部分设置`PersistentKeepalive = 25`(单位:秒)。这个值不宜过小(增加无用流量)也不宜过大(保活不及时)。合理配置此参数能确保您的QuickQ VPN隧道在游戏过程中始终保持活跃,避免因NAT超时而造成的卡顿。
3. 系统网络参数与拥塞控制算法
操作系统本身的网络栈参数也会影响WireGuard的性能。例如,可以尝试启用TCP BBR等现代拥塞控制算法来提升带宽利用率和降低延迟(在Linux服务器端配置效果更显著)。对于客户端,确保系统电源选项设置为“高性能”,以避免节能机制对网络适配器的干扰。
此外,对于Windows用户,可以尝试修改注册表或使用优化工具调整TCP窗口大小等参数。这些底层优化与QuickQ的应用层加速相结合,能从端到端全面改善网络流体的传输效率。
4. 路由策略与分流优化
并非所有流量都需要经过VPN。将游戏流量精准地路由至WireGuard隧道,而让下载、视频等流量走本地直连,可以减少隧道负载和潜在冲突。这需要通过配置精确的路由规则来实现。例如,在WireGuard配置中,可以精心设计`AllowedIPs`字段,仅包含游戏服务器IP段或需要加速的特定目标网络,而不是默认的`0.0.0.0/0`(全局流量)。
QuickQ客户端通常具备智能分流功能,但了解其原理后,高级用户可以进行手动微调,确保游戏数据包始终优先通过最优路径转发,从而获得更稳定的加速效果。
5. 案例分析:竞技游戏《英雄联盟》欧服加速
场景:国内玩家希望稳定连接至欧洲服务器进行游戏,初始延迟高达200ms以上,且时有跳ping。
优化前:使用QuickQ默认配置连接至一个泛欧节点,延迟降至160ms,但仍有波动。
优化步骤:
1. 在QuickQ节点列表中,选择专门标记为“游戏低延迟”且位于德国或法国的节点,延迟测试显示为150ms。
2. 通过ping测试,将WireGuard隧道的MTU值从1420调整为1392。
3. 设置`PersistentKeepalive = 20`,防止家庭路由器NAT断线。
4. 在QuickQ的分流规则中,设置为仅代理《英雄联盟》欧服的IP地址范围。
优化后:平均延迟稳定在148-152ms之间,跳ping现象基本消失,游戏体验显著改善。
总结
WireGuard协议的性能潜力需要通过细致的调优才能完全释放。从选择优质节点、调整MTU和Keepalive参数,到优化系统网络栈和实施精准分流,每一个环节都可能成为降低延迟、提升稳定性的关键。对于追求极致网络体验的用户,尤其是依赖QuickQ进行游戏加速的用户,理解和应用这些技术层面的优化技巧,能够将现有的优质服务推向一个新的高度,最终实现更快速、更可靠的网络连接。记住,网络优化是一个持续的过程,结合工具的性能与个人的调优,方能打造最适合自己的高速通道。